The Knicks-Pacers rivalry is deeply rooted in NBA history, with memorable clashes in the 1990s featuring iconic players like Reggie Miller. This resurgence marks a new chapter, with both teams strategically positioned for sustained success.
**Knicks' Strategy:** The Knicks' ability to remain competitive hinges on Jalen Brunson's team-friendly contract, allowing them flexibility in roster construction. Despite recent trades, they aim to bolster their depth while staying under the second apron.
**Pacers' Financial Commitment:** The Pacers are considering entering the luxury tax for the first time since 2005 to retain key players like Myles Turner. This decision reflects a shift in organizational philosophy, prioritizing long-term competitiveness.
**Eastern Conference Landscape:** The Celtics and Cavaliers face potential roster challenges due to salary cap constraints, creating an opening for the Knicks and Pacers to establish themselves as long-term contenders. This shift could reshape the balance of power in the Eastern Conference for years to come.
